2015-04-28 69 views
0

我尝试使用仪表板把这个HTML到我的网页内容:将HTML的标签到WordPress页面使用仪表板

<div> 
    <p class="text-center"> 
     <a class="btn btn-large btn-light" title="Kontakt" href="/?page_id=20">Kontakt <i class="fa fa-phone"></i></a> 

     <a class="btn btn-large btn-light" title="Standorte &amp; Informationen" href="/?page_id=20">Standorte &amp; 
      Informationen <i class="fa fa-globe"></i></a> 
    </p> 
</div> 

但这里是HTML我得到页:

<div> 
    <p class="text-center"> 
     <a class="btn btn-large btn-light" title="Kontakt" href="/?page_id=20">Kontakt <i class="fa fa-phone"></i></a> 
    </p> 
    <p> 
     <a class="btn btn-large btn-light" title="Standorte &amp; Informationen" href="/?page_id=20">Standorte &amp;<br /> 
     Informationen <i class="fa fa-globe"></i></a> 
    </p> 
</div> 

看到不同?那么为什么它会生成两个<p>,并且首先有我正在分类的课程?也许这是我的错误,我没有得到一些WordPress的东西?

回答

2

wpautop可能处于活动状态,如果您输入的代码中有双行换行符,则插入第二个p

尝试删除两个a -elements之间的空行,它应该工作。

+0

Upvoted食品法典委员会链接:d – Musk

+0

两个答案goodm的感谢! – nowiko

2

它做与WordPress的默认格式化过滤

将此放在您的functions.php

remove_filter('the_content', 'wpautop'); 
+0

快8秒。 :-P – flomei

+0

我仍然放置代码:P – Musk

+0

我必须得到codex链接......好吧......呃......不管。 ;-) – flomei